Ergonomic Desk Chairs Provide Lumbar Support
It is no secret that the term lumbar support has turned into a buzzword in the office furniture niche, and many manufacturers tend to use these terms freely. However, what most of these ordinary office chairs do not provide is adjustability. Not being able to adjust the lumbar support according to your body shape and size means you could potentially be putting even more pressure on the wrong part of your back. An ergonomic oddice chair fixes that by providing a shape that makes sense for your back and letting you adjust the point where you want to feel the pressure so that your back is firmly held in the correct position.

Ergonomic Office Chairs Help Reduce Pain
People who need to sit for long periods on their office chairs often complain about developing pain in their lower back or sciatic area. This is because their body becomes stiff from being in the wrong position, and the muscles eventually start to ache due to being held in an unnatural state. Using an ergonomic office chair sets things right and lets your muscles relax through posture correction. A lot of features come into play here, including the lumbar support, the seat positioning, the adjustable height, the swivel, and good headrests as well.

Relax Your Hips
The part of your body that bears most of the pressure when sitting on a computer chair is your hips. They are holding your body’s weight the entire time, and if they are not in the correct position, it can lead to a lot of pain and stiffness. Not addressing this problem can lead to permanent damage over the years. With ergonomic office chairs, you can adjust the seat’s positioning to ensure your hips are fully supported and do not feel too much pressure. A good quality ergonomic computer chair also provides thick and dense cushioning to maximize comfort for your hips and, as a result, your entire upper body.

Highly Adjustable Positioning
What makes an ergonomic office chairs good at its job is the wide range of adjustability it offers its user. This means the office chair can be adjusted to accommodate people of all heights and sizes. Everyone has a different physique, so expecting them to sit in the same chair design would be unfair. Some of the things that you can adjust on an ergonomic office chairs include lumbar support, the position of armrests and headrests, adjustable height, swivel locking, how high and deep the seat can go, and of course, the recline angle. Each of these adjustments comes into play when creating the perfect sitting position of office chairs, both for work and for play.

Check the Height and Width Range
Your physique plays the most significant role in deciding which chair would suit your needs the best. Figure out how much sitting space you need and how high you want to sit, and then match them with the height and width options in the office chairs you are choosing from. While height adjustment is easily covered for most people in highly ergonomic office chairs, the width can sometimes be an issue. The Aeron chair by Herman Miller addresses this problem by offering three different width options. Furthermore, being able to move the seat forward and back in its position can also have an impact on your decision.

Adjustable Lumbar Support
Having your back supported at the perfect angle is crucial to ensuring that you have the best possible lumbar support on your chair. The ideal option is to look for a chair that allows you to change how high or low you want to feel the chair supporting you on your back. Most ergonomic office chairs do come with this feature, but it is still best to ensure they are available in your chair.
-
Cushion and Back Material
The ideal option for people who want to sit in their chairs for long hours would be a chair that provides ample cushioning. Some chairs are designed to be stiff to keep the user from sitting too long, and if that is not your routine, then you must avoid those options. The back should also be comfortable and breathable to ensure you do not drench yourself in sweat from long hours of sitting in the same place.
